Significance of Proper Pose



Proper pose is crucial in preserving a healthy back and protecting against discomfort. When you rest or stand with great posture, your spinal column remains in alignment, lowering strain on your muscular tissues, tendons, and joints. This placement permits the body to distribute weight uniformly, stopping extreme stress on particular areas that can lead to discomfort and pain. By maintaining your spinal column appropriately lined up, you can likewise boost your breathing and digestion, as slouching can press body organs and limit their functionality.

In addition, maintaining great stance can improve your overall look and self-esteem. When you stand tall with your shoulders back and head held high, you emanate self-confidence and appear more approachable. Good stance can likewise make you feel extra invigorated and alert, as it promotes appropriate blood circulation and enables your muscular tissues to function effectively.

Incorporating proper posture into your everyday routine, whether sitting at a desk, strolling, or working out, is vital for preventing neck and back pain and advertising overall well-being. Remember, a small change in how you hold yourself can make a considerable distinction in just how you really feel and work throughout the day.

Common Postural Mistakes



When it pertains to maintaining excellent position, many people unknowingly make typical errors that can add to back pain and discomfort. Among one of the most common mistakes is slumping over or stooping over while sitting or standing. This placement puts extreme pressure on the back and can result in muscle mass discrepancies and discomfort in the long run.

One more usual blunder is overarching the lower back, which can flatten the all-natural curve of the spinal column and trigger discomfort. In addition, going across legs while resting may feel comfortable, however it can develop an imbalance in the hips and hips, bring about postural issues.

Using a cushion that's too soft or too strong while resting can also affect your positioning and add to pain in the back. Lastly, frequently craning your neck to take a look at screens or adjusting your position frequently can strain the neck and shoulders. Bearing in mind these typical postural mistakes can help you maintain better alignment and minimize the risk of pain in the back.
